Overview
ISO 13584-101:2003 - "Industrial automation systems and integration - Parts library - Part 101" - defines the basic_geometry representation category and the protocol for exchanging geometrical views of parts by parametric programs. The standard specifies how shape information for parts in a parts library can be represented and exchanged using FORTRAN programs that implement the geometric programming interface defined in ISO 13584-31:1999. By agreement between sender and receiver, non‑standard parametric formats may also be used.
Key Topics
- Representation category (basic_geometry): Captures the generic concept of a part’s shape and may be associated with any parts library item.
- Identification and properties: Defines view logical names, view control variables (e.g., side, geometry level, detail level, variant/unregistered variant) and rules for the shapes provided in the basic_geometry view.
- Exchange format (parametric program): Specifies exchange by FORTRAN subroutines compliant with ISO 13584-31, including required subroutine naming, language restrictions, excluded/obsolete FORTRAN features, character encoding and program status.
- Conformance requirements: Lists required implementation resources, methods, and constraints for a library delivery file referencing the protocol, including defined conformance classes and related compliance tables and rules.
- Supplementary material: Normative registration of information objects and an informative annexe with a physical file example.
Applications
ISO 13584-101 is practical for:
- CAD and PLM vendors implementing parts libraries and geometric programming interfaces to enable neutral exchange of parametric shapes.
- Manufacturers and suppliers who publish parametric part geometry in a neutral, standardized way for downstream consumers.
- System integrators building library exchange workflows between CAD, CAM and ERP systems.
- Software developers writing FORTRAN bindings or converters that conform to ISO 13584-31 and ISO 13584-101.
Benefits include consistent parametric shape exchange, interoperability of parts libraries, and support for automated generation of geometry from parametric programs.
Related Standards
- ISO 13584-31:1999 - Geometric programming interface (mandatory binding for FORTRAN exchange).
- ISO 13584-1, -24, -26, -42 - Parts library overview, logical models and description methodology referenced for library structure and metadata.
- ISO 10303 (STEP) and ISO 10303-42 - Product data representation and geometric/topological resources referenced for definitions and resources.
